अब सिस्टम इतने शक्तिशाली हैं, कुछ 8-बिट माइक्रो और 64kb से कम स्मृति के साथ सबसे अधिक प्राप्त करने की कोशिश करने की मजेदार चुनौती जैसी कुछ प्रतीत नहीं होती है। क्या कुछ है (यह एक एमुलेटर नहीं है) जो एक समान अनुभव प्रदान कर सकता है?प्रोग्रामिंग के लिए कम लागत वाले इलेक्ट्रॉनिक किट का एक अच्छा टुकड़ा क्या है?
उत्तर
चेक बाहर http://www.arduino.cc/। यदि आप इसके लिए Google हैं तो इसके आधार पर कई परियोजना विचार हैं।
एक मजेदार परियोजना के लिए beagleboard देखें।
EdSim51 एक नि: शुल्क 8051 सिम्युलेटर है। 8051 एक महान माइक्रोकंट्रोलर है।
सिम्युलेटर में वर्चुअल कीपैड और एलसीडी डिस्प्ले है।
बेसिक टिकट भी अच्छे हैं।
http://www.radioshack.com/product/index.jsp?productId=2117994 http://www.parallax.com/tabid/295/Default.aspx
मैं हमेशा BASIC Stamp मॉड्यूल का प्रयास करना चाहता था लेकिन कभी भी समय नहीं मिला।
Adafruit Industries से उपलब्ध कई किट 8-बिट एवीआर माइक्रोकंट्रोलर पर आधारित हैं, जो इलेक्ट्रॉनिक्स और प्रोग्रामिंग टिंकरिंग के लिए उत्कृष्ट हैं।
पर $ 20 चलाएगा, वे कुछ Arduino किट भी बेचते हैं। –
Arduino एक महान स्टार्टर सीपीयू है। मैंने अन्य एवीआर माइक्रोप्रोसेसरों को प्रोग्राम करने के लिए बोर्डुइनो का भी उपयोग किया है। बेसिक टिकटों का उपयोग करना आसान है, लेकिन मुझे लगता है कि आपको जो भी मिलता है वह मूल्य खराब है।
एवीआर प्लगइन्स के साथ ग्रहण एक महान Arduino विकास पर्यावरण (जो मैं अभी उपयोग करता हूं) बनाता है।
What’s the best way to learn how to build circuits प्रश्न के जवाब में वर्णित कुछ रोचक किट भी हैं।
यदि आप बस मजेदार आउट ऑफ़ बॉक्स प्रोग्रामिंग चाहते हैं, तो Tandy TRS-80 Model 100 पर एक नज़र डालें। यह तुरंत बूट हो जाता है, 4 एए बैटरी पर चलता है, एक बहुत ही तेज एलसीडी डिस्प्ले है और बेसिक में बनाया गया है। कीबोर्ड शानदार है! एक कामकाजी मॉडल $ 75 जितना कम हो सकता है (Club 100 Store देखें)।
मुझे 8-बिट एवीआर माइक्रोकंट्रोलर पसंद हैं, लेकिन कभी-कभी बड़ी एलसीडी, एक व्याख्या की गई भाषा और कीबोर्ड होना अच्छा होता है। मज़े करो।
- 1. इलेक्ट्रॉनिक घटक प्रोग्रामिंग प्रश्न
- 2. सॉकेट प्रोग्रामिंग के लिए एक अच्छा बफर आकार क्या है?
- 3. कम स्मृति उपयोग के लिए एक अच्छा डेटाबेस क्या है?
- 4. क्या "लिखने वाले तेज़ प्रबंधित कोड: जानना क्या चीजें लागत" का एक अद्यतन संस्करण है?
- 5. मार्ग समस्या: कम से कम कुल लागत
- 6. जावास्क्रिप्ट का उपयोग कर कार्यात्मक शैली वेब प्रोग्रामिंग के लिए एक अच्छा उदाहरण क्या है?
- 7. क्या पहले और अंतिम नामों का एक मुफ्त (या कम लागत वाला) डेटाबेस है?
- 8. डिजिटलमार्स डी प्रोग्रामिंग के लिए सबसे अच्छा आईडीई क्या है?
- 9. कार्यात्मक प्रोग्रामिंग पर एक अच्छा प्रारंभिक पाठ क्या है?
- 10. क्लोजर के लिए एक अच्छा प्रदर्शन क्या है?
- 11. गणित कम करें/हल करें: गैर-दोहराने वाले मानों के लिए पूछने का सबसे अच्छा तरीका
- 12. क्या आप .NET Winforms एप्लिकेशन के लिए कम लागत वाले स्वचालित परीक्षण टूल की अनुशंसा कर सकते हैं?
- 13. मेटा प्रोग्रामिंग, यह किसके लिए अच्छा है?
- 14. उपयोगकर्ता अनुभव डिजाइन को एकीकृत करने के कम लागत वाले तरीके?
- 15. document.write का उपयोग करने वाले आलसी लोड वाले डबलक्लिक विज्ञापनों का सबसे अच्छा तरीका क्या है?
- 16. जावा - क्या यह अच्छा प्रोग्रामिंग अभ्यास है?
- 17. पायथन में सीजीआई प्रोग्रामिंग सीखने के लिए एक अच्छा संसाधन क्या है?
- 18. सबसे कम पथ पेड़ की कुल लागत को कम करने के लिए कैसे करें
- 19. प्रोग्रामिंग भाषा लिखने के लिए एक अच्छा संसाधन क्या है, यह संदर्भ मुक्त नहीं है?
- 20. गोलांग में मानचित्र से मूल्यों का एक टुकड़ा प्राप्त करने का एक अच्छा तरीका है?
- 21. प्रोग्रामिंग भाषा में अच्छा होने का क्या अर्थ है?
- 22. कम विलंबता प्रोग्रामिंग
- 23. प्रोग्रामिंग के माध्यम से संगीत बनाने के लिए एक अच्छा एपीआई क्या है?
- 24. .NET प्रतिबिंब की "लागत" क्या है?
- 25. एक couchdb डेटाबेस का बैकअप बनाने के लिए कम से कम घुसपैठ विधि क्या है?
- 26. #define की लागत क्या है?
- 27. क्या कोड परमाणु (सी #) का एक टुकड़ा बनाना संभव है?
- 28. क्या लिनक्स के लिए एक अच्छा "ओकैमल ब्राउज़र" उपकरण है?
- 29. मशीन सीखने के लिए एक अच्छा पहला कार्यान्वयन क्या है?
- 30. क्या "प्रोग्रामिंग" नीचे एक प्रोग्रामिंग भाषा है?
इनके लिए छोटे डिस्प्ले के विकल्प क्या हैं, उदा। एलसीडी/OLED? –
मेरी इच्छा है कि मैं इसका उत्तर दे सकूं लेकिन मैंने अभी तक Arduino के साथ tinkering शुरू नहीं किया है। –
दुर्भाग्यवश Arduino टच शील्ड कम लागत नहीं है। –